Tool life in Turning Processes: Effect of Lubricants with a small amount of Graphite as Cutting Fluid
This study aims to determine the effect of various lubricant-based cutting fluid parameters to produce an optimal tool life in turning operations. This research does not use coolant as a cooling fluid, but as a lubricant with the addition of a small amount of graphite (solid lubricant) at a minimum...
